Introduction to DSA Syllabus 2026
Data Structures and Algorithms (DSA) is one of the most important parts of programming. It helps in organizing data properly and solving problems step by step using logic. A well-structured data structures and algorithms tutorial teaches how to write efficient and optimized code.
Instead of just coding, DSA focuses on thinking in a structured way. That is why every good dsa tutorial starts with building strong fundamentals.
Importance of DSA in Modern Programming
In 2026, technology is growing faster than ever. Applications need to be quick, scalable, and efficient. The dsa syllabus helps developers build systems that perform better and handle large data smoothly.
Without DSA, even simple problems can become difficult. With it, complex problems become manageable.
How This 2026 Curriculum is Structured
This dsa guide 2026 is designed step by step. It starts from basic concepts and moves towards advanced topics. The structure ensures clarity and makes learning easy for beginners as well as experienced learners.
Why Learning DSA is Important in 2026
Role in Software Development
Every software application depends on how efficiently data is handled. A strong understanding of a data structures and algorithms tutorial helps in building fast and reliable systems.
Importance in Technical Interviews
DSA is the core of technical interviews. Most companies test candidates based on problem-solving skills. Following a proper dsa tutorial increases chances of success.
Real-World Applications
- E-commerce platforms use sorting and searching
- GPS systems use graph algorithms
- Social networks use graphs and hashing
Prerequisites Before Starting DSA
Programming Language Basics (C/C++/Java/Python)
Before starting the dsa syllabus, basic programming knowledge is required.
Problem-Solving Mindset
DSA is more about logic than coding. A clear mindset helps in solving problems faster.
Basic Mathematics & Logic
Understanding patterns, recursion, and logical flow helps in mastering the dsa guide 2026.
Step-by-Step DSA Syllabus (Updated 2026 Curriculum)
1. Fundamentals of DSA
This section introduces the basics of data structures and algorithms. It covers linear and non-linear structures and builds the foundation of the data structures and algorithms tutorial.
2. Complexity Analysis
Time and space complexity are used to measure performance. Concepts like Big-O notation help compare different algorithms and choose the best one.
3. Core Data Structures
Core topics include arrays, strings, linked lists, stacks, and queues. These are the building blocks of the dsa syllabus and are widely used in programming.
4. Advanced Data Structures
Advanced topics include hashing, trees, heaps, graphs, and tries. These concepts are important for solving complex problems and are a key part of any dsa tutorial.
5. Sorting Algorithms
Sorting algorithms help in organizing data. From simple methods to advanced techniques, this section strengthens problem-solving skills.
6. Searching Algorithms
Searching algorithms like linear search and binary search improve efficiency while finding data.
7. Algorithm Design Techniques
This part focuses on approaches like recursion, greedy methods, divide and conquer, and dynamic programming. These are essential for mastering any data structures and algorithms tutorial.
8. Graph Algorithms
Graph algorithms are used in real-world applications like networking and navigation systems. BFS, DFS, and shortest path algorithms are covered here.
9. Advanced Problem-Solving Topics
Topics like LCS, TSP, and string matching help in improving logical thinking and preparing for advanced-level questions.
10. Concept Comparison & Optimization
Understanding differences between concepts like stack vs queue or DFS vs BFS helps in selecting the right approach while coding.
Practical Implementation & Coding Practice
Practice plays a major role in mastering DSA. Reading a dsa tutorial is not enough without solving problems.
Regular practice improves speed, accuracy, and confidence. Following structured platforms like Wscube Tech helps learners understand concepts through real examples and guided practice.
DSA for Interviews Preparation
Interview preparation requires consistency and smart practice. The focus should be on solving problems using patterns.
A proper dsa guide 2026 helps in identifying important topics and preparing efficiently. Regular revision and mock interviews improve performance.
Who Should Follow This DSA Curriculum?
- Beginners starting programming
- Students preparing for placements
- Professionals aiming for growth
- Career switchers entering tech
This dsa syllabus is suitable for anyone who wants to build strong coding skills.
Best Way to Learn DSA in 2026
Step-by-Step Learning Strategy
Start with basics and gradually move to advanced topics.
Practice Roadmap
Daily problem-solving is the key to success in any data structures and algorithms tutorial.
Mistakes to Avoid
- Ignoring fundamentals
- Lack of practice
- Learning without understanding
A structured learning path, like the one offered by Wscube Tech, makes the journey smooth and effective.
FAQs About DSA Syllabus
1. What is DSA syllabus?
It includes data structures, algorithms, and problem-solving techniques.
2. Is DSA important for coding interviews?
Yes, most companies focus on DSA-based questions.
3. How to start a dsa tutorial?
Start with basics like arrays and move step by step.
4. Which language is best for DSA?
Python, Java, and C++ are commonly used.
5. How long does it take to complete DSA syllabus?
Usually 3β6 months with regular practice.
6. Is DSA hard for beginners?
No, a proper dsa guide 2026 makes it easy.
7. Can non-tech students learn DSA?
Yes, with consistent practice and the right guidance like Wscube Tech.
8. What is the best way to practice DSA?
Solve problems daily and revise concepts.
9. Are data structures and algorithms used in real life?
Yes, they are used in apps, websites, and systems.
10. Where to learn DSA effectively?
Structured platforms like Wscube Tech provide easy and practical learning.
Conclusion
The dsa syllabus 2026 is designed to build strong problem-solving skills and prepare learners for real-world challenges. A structured data structures and algorithms tutorial helps in understanding concepts step by step and applying them effectively.
Consistency, practice, and the right guidance make a huge difference. For learners looking for a simple and reliable way to master DSA, Wscube Tech provides one of the best platforms to learn and grow with confidence.

Top comments (0)